Output 68e43bb1b8c3999bcc55672b1e846fb49c1cb66138e43dd02565e313fa1d5574:0

value
140280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9375d4c7bf14619e86b58b32fa79b383eff46faa OP_EQUAL
address
3F8iQo8ptyE3S9DXuDvUdR7bS4zfWEWqHX
transaction
68e43bb1b8c3999bcc55672b1e846fb49c1cb66138e43dd02565e313fa1d5574
confirmations
174383
spent
true